Adventures and Dive Travel Vacations in Indonesia
 
Indonesia, the world’s largest archipelago, is an incredible, vast region with thousands of islands in the Indo-Pacific waters between Australia and Malaysia. It is home to the most biological diverse coral reef systems in the world consisting of everything from coral atolls, to steep deeply submerged volcanoes. Land Based options from Bali and Sulawesi and the remote Wakatobi all offer excellent diving options. Additionally there are several liveabord boats as well. |

Murex – North Sulawesi
Containing three distinct and different dive resorts and the choice of two liveaboard vessels, Murex dive centre is one of the leading dive centres in North Sulawesi. Guests can dive Bunaken, Bangka, Lembeh Strait (the muck diving capital of the world) and the Sangihe-Talaud archipelago all via the one dive centre. Over 100 dive sites are within an easy boat ride from the three resorts, and the two liveaboards add literally dozens more in the Sangihe-Talaud archipelago that stretches almost to the Philippines.
